Police still seek suspect in string of robberies in Henrico, Chesterfield
HENRICO COUNTY, Va. (WRIC) -- The Henrico County Police Division is seeking the public's assistance in locating a man in connection to several robberies in Henrico and Chesterfield counties.
Between Jan. 16 and March 8, law enforcement in both Henrico and Chesterfield counties have responded to several reports of robberies.
According to Henrico Police, these incidents were connected to businesses in Henrico County's west end.
Police described the person of interest as a Black or Hispanic man, who stands 5 feet, 5 inches tall. He is said to usually enter a place of business wearing a mask and gloves, while also being armed with a silver handgun.
